U.S. Embassy Phnom Penh, Cambodia

Security Message for U.S. Citizens: Possible Demonstrations in Phnom Penh

September 5, 2016



The United States Embassy in Phnom Penh alerts U.S. citizens residing in or traveling to Cambodia of the possibility of political demonstrations in Phnom Penh on Monday, September 5. The Cambodia National Rescue Party (CNRP) has announced planned demonstrations at or around CNRP Headquarters, located at 576 National Road 2, as well as at or around the Phnom Penh Municipal Court, located on Samdech Monireth Blvd. Additional demonstrations may occur throughout Phnom Penh through the week of September 5, including in the areas surrounding CNRP‎ headquarters and the Phnom Penh Municipal Court.



U.S. citizens are reminded of the Embassy’s existing guidance that even demonstrations intended to be peaceful can turn confrontational and have the potential to escalate into violence without warning. The U.S. Embassy recommends you avoid areas where demonstrations are taking place and exercise caution when in the vicinity of any large gatherings, protests or demonstrations and immediately leave any area where there are large gatherings. You should remain alert of local security developments by monitoring local news reports, exercising vigilance regarding your preparedness and personal security, remaining aware of your surroundings, and planning your activities accordingly.
